
Emergency services are responding to a “well-involved” vehicle fire after it collided with a garage and burst into flames, leaving a person seriously injured.
Police said they are responding to a single-vehicle crash on Station Rd, Tapanui, reported just after 3.30pm.
“A vehicle is reported to have collided with a garage, the vehicle has then caught fire,” police said.
The road is currently blocked, and motorists are advised to avoid the area.
Fire and Emergency New Zealand said they responded to a “well-involved” motor vehicle fire at the property.
Two crews attended the incident and worked to extinguish the fire.
Hato Hone St John said they were notified of a motor vehicle incident on Station Rd and responded with one ambulance.
Initial indications are that there are serious injuries, police said.
